Dataset Overview
This dataset contains resampled magnetometer data from the Pioneer Venus
Orbiter spacecraft beginning with orbit 3602 (Oct 16, 1988) and continuing
until the orbiter was lost in the Venusian atmosphere (orbit 5055,
Oct 7, 1992). The dataset differs from the 2 spin period averaged mag dataset
from the previous orbits due to an anomaly in the multiplexor that controlled
the sampling of the magnetometer sensors. During orbit 3602, and for the
remainder of the mission, the spacecraft downlink contained magnetometer
data from only the P sensor. The P sensor is the sensor which is aligned with
the spacecraft spin axis, nominally in the direction of the ecliptic normal.
Version 2.0 of this data set includes new versions of some of the data
products. The ancillary engineering (ENGR) were regenerated
setting bad data to flag values. The original, unflagged data values
are available in the binary version of the same data.
After the anomaly was first detected, the magnetometer team made a
substantial effort to recover the average magnetic field vector using the
single sensor data. Since the sensor is not perfectly aligned with the
spacecraftspin axis, a small amount of spin modulation is present in the
sensor data. In theory, the amplitude of the spin plane field can be
determined from the amplitude of the spin modulation and knowledge of the
true sensor mounting geometry. In practice, this turned out to be a very
difficult task because the spin axis of the spacecraft is not sufficiently
constant in body-fixed coordinates.
Data Processing and Sampling
This dataset has been calibrated to account for gains only.
The data are given in units of nanoTesla. The data have been
derived from the high resolution dataset PVO-V-OMAG-3-P-SENSOR-V1.0
by resampling. These data have been averaged over two spin period intervals
on one spin period centers. The time tag given to each record is the project
assigned time value for the spin period (UADS time tag).
The dataset contains the following columns:
Column Description
___________________________________________________________________________
UT S/C event time (UT) of the sample
Bz-SC Calibrated/Averaged value of S/C coord. Z component of B
Var-Bz The variance of Bz-sc over the two spin period interval
Bn The magnetic field magnitude |B|.
Ancillary Products
Other datasets on the CD-ROM are the Ephemeris which contains spacecraft
position in Venus Solar Orbital coordinates, spacecraft altitude, solar
zenith angle, Venus centered longitude and latitude, spacecraft spin axis
components, celestial longitude and latitude of the spacecraft, celestial
longitude of the earth, and the Sun-spacecraft range.
Other ancillary datasets are the: 1) phase and offset which contains the
phase amplitude of sun synchronous modulation of the 4 signals (E100, E730,
E5.4 and E30K), and offsets of the G sensor. 2) The engineering dataset which
contains temperatures, magnetometer modes, magnetometer sample format,
magnetometer spin average select, telemetry data format, telemetry bit rate,
spacecraft spin period, pulse time, the difference between the Sun pulse time
and the Rip pulse time, and the pulse time flag.
